In this preview, the Copa del Rey Round of 16 serves up a classic David vs. Goliath narrative as Racing Santander prepares to host the mighty FC Barcelona at the Estadio El Sardinero. While Racing Santander has been enjoying a strong season in the Segunda Division, currently sitting as promotion contenders, they face the ultimate litmus test against a Barcelona side that has been imperious under Hansi Flick. The atmosphere in Cantabria will be electric, and for punters, this match offers a fascinating blend of “cup magic” potential and the clinical efficiency of one of Europe’s top-scoring teams.

As we dive into this match preview, the focus shifts to whether the hosts can leverage their home advantage to cause a historic upset. Barcelona has been in relentless form, recently thrashing Athletic Bilbao 5-0 and consistently finding the net with ease. Racing Santander vs Barcelona H2H

  • Historical Dominance: Barcelona has won all of the last 5 meetings between these two clubs, dating back to their time together in La Liga.
  • Goal Glut: The last three encounters between these sides have produced a total of 12 goals (an average of 4 per game).
  • Clean Sheet Record: Barcelona has kept a clean sheet in 4 of their last 5 matches against Racing Santander.
  • Sardinero History: The last time these two met at El Sardinero, Barcelona walked away with a 2-0 victory.

Team News: Racing Santander

Racing Santander manager Jose Lopez has a relatively healthy squad but will likely be without midfielder Maguette Gueye due to a minor knock. The team will lean heavily on Aitor Crespo and their top scorer to find a way through the Barcelona defense. Their strategy will focus on a compact low-block to frustrate the visitors for as long as possible.

Team News: Barcelona

Barcelona continues to manage a high-profile injury list, though the squad depth remains elite. Long-term absentees include Gavi and Marc-Andre ter Stegen. However, Hansi Flick is expected to rotate slightly, potentially giving starts to Ferran Torres and young talents like Roony Bardghji, while keeping the core of the team strong enough to avoid a cup upset.
